Free Presentation : Secretary of the Department of Foreign Affairs and Trade, Ms Frances Adamson on The Indo-Pacific: A Western Australian Perspective Other events...
The Perth USAsia Centre is honoured to host Ms Frances Adamson, Secretary of the Department of Foreign Affairs and Trade for a public presentation on ‘The Indo-Pacific: A WA Perspective'. The Indo-Pacific region is a central focus of the 2017 Foreign Policy White Paper. The White Paper recognised Australia’s shifting regional landscape, and identified the promotion of an open, inclusive and prosperous Indo-Pacific region as critical for both Australia’s and the region’s security and prosperity. Due to its unique position on the Indian Ocean, and as a commercial gateway for Australia to the region, Western Australia has a significant role to play in the Indo-Pacific. This event provides the opportunity to gain insight into the role of Western Australia can play in Australia’s foreign policy approach to the Indo-Pacific region.
